iShares Environmental Infrastructure and Industrials ETF (NASDAQ:EFRA – Get Free Report) was the recipient of a significant growth in short interest in the month of April. As of April 30th, there was short interest totaling 3,655 shares, a growth of 128.6% from the April 15th total of 1,599 shares. Based on an average trading volume of 879 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 4.2 days. Currently, 2.3% of the company’s stock are sold short.
iShares Environmental Infrastructure and Industrials ETF Stock Performance
iShares Environmental Infrastructure and Industrials ETF stock traded down $0.82 during mid-day trading on Friday, reaching $34.23. The stock had a trading volume of 393 shares, compared to its average volume of 693. iShares Environmental Infrastructure and Industrials ETF has a fifty-two week low of $32.37 and a fifty-two week high of $37.46. The stock’s 50-day simple moving average is $35.12 and its 200-day simple moving average is $34.82. The firm has a market capitalization of $5.48 million, a PE ratio of 21.28 and a beta of 0.81.
